About William Band

William Band

William Band is now a resident of Erin, Ontario. His love of painting was evident from his early childhood. Throughout his school years William was fortunate to expand his creativity by studying with such respected Canadian artists as Alan Collier, Bill Stidsworthy, Franklin Arbuckle to name but a few. After graduating with honors from the Ontario College of Art and Design in Toronto, and a successful career in commercial art, Wiliam went back to his first love, painting. His paintings are from his travels during the year. Starting in May he can be found canoeing in the Northern lakes or sketching on location in small rural town.
